post-process: Handle python 3.7 header formats

Python 3.7 adds a flags field which modified the offset of the mtime,
as well as adds a new non-mtime based check mode.

magic = buffer[0] + (buffer[1] << 8);
/* All magic listed here: https://github.com/python/cpython/blob/HEAD/Lib/importlib/_bootstrap_external.py#L167
* 3392 is the first (3.7) which added an extra flags field in the header.
* 20121 is the first higher major listed (1.5), and all other non-py3 ones are higher.
*/
if (magic >= 3392 && magic < 20121)
{
/* From the spec:
* The pyc header currently consists of 3 32-bit words. We will expand it to 4.
* The first word will continue to be the magic number, versioning the bytecode and pyc format.
* The second word, conceptually the new word, will be a bit field.
* The interpretation of the rest of the header and invalidation behavior of the pyc depends on the contents of the bit field.
*/
header_flag =
(buffer[4] << 8*0) |
(buffer[5] << 8*1) |
(buffer[6] << 8*2) |
(buffer[7] << 8*3);
/* If the bit field is 0, the pyc is a traditional timestamp-based pyc. I.e., the third
and forth words will be the timestamp and file size respectively, and invalidation
will be done by comparing the metadata of the source file with that in the header. */
if (header_flag != 0)
{
/* Non-mtime based verification, like hash if low bit is 1,
* or other future added methods. No need to do anything*/
return TRUE;
}
mtime_offset = 8;
}
else
{
mtime_offset = 4;
}
